Jake Fortina can’t believe the news. Children—over 20,000 since February 2022—are disappearing as Russia invades Ukraine. Ukrainian Air Force Colonel Hennadiy Kovalenko and his wife, Mila, suffer heart-rending losses. Private Margarita Romanova, a medic in the Russian Army, faces a terrible dilemma, one that also holds the possibility of love and redemption. And in the background, Sergiy and Gleb, two young Ukrainian boys deported to Russia, must endure devastating and hellish circumstances. An unlikely confluence of Ukrainian, American, Italian, and Russian citizens unites to mount a rescue. The stakes have never been higher.
